About Gaza Ridge Health Centre
n
The Gaza Ridge Health Centre is located on Gaza Ridge South at Bandiana near Wodonga. The Albury Wodonga Military Area consists of 3 barracks and is home to the Army's Logistic Training Centre, Joint Logistics Unit Victoria and Schooling in various areas. This is a large base providing services to over 5000 Defence Force members. The health centre provides primary medical, dental, nursing, physiotherapy, mental health, and pharmaceutical care. There is also a 20-bed low dependency ward which operates 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.
The standard operating hours are 07:30 – 15:30 Monday – Friday (depending on role requirements and specific craft groups required for weekend and on‐call shifts).
